Today’s Psalms are mainly attributed to the sons of Korah. The question is, who are they? Here is an excellent read on who they are, and that’s why genealogies are so important. We read about Korah, who revolted against Moses and Aaron in the book of Numbers. The ground had opened up to swallow Korah and his family; however, some of his sons did not die (Numbers 26:10&11).

Now we see them writing Psalms. God still used Korah’s descendants despite what he did. It shows that irrespective of where we come from, we can still be used by God.
